Jason Blum Is ‘Super Excited’ For Patrick Wilson’s Directorial Debut With Insidious: Fear The Dark

Jason Blum says he’s really excited to see Patrick Wilson step behind the camera to direct his first feature film.


After spending a lot of time in front of the camera for the horror genre, actor Patrick Wilson will step behind it for the upcoming sequel Treacherous: Fear the dark. The fifth installment of the Treacherous film series, the film is slated for a summer 2023 release. While Wilson returns to reprise his role in the series as Josh Lambert, he simultaneously serves as director and makes his directorial debut.


In a new interview with THR, producer Jason Blum commented on Wilson’s transition to the director’s chair. From his point of view, Blum can’t help but feel great excitement for the film knowing that Wilson is directing. Blum knows Wilson as a movie buff, which always makes their experiences working on movies together that much more enjoyable.

“Well, we all love Patrick. I did one or two movies with that guy. (laughs.) But I’m super excited about what Patrick is up to Treacherous. One of the things I love most about working with Patrick Wilson is that we don’t really talk about the movie we’re making on set. We love all the movies we loved growing up because Patrick and I are pretty much the same generation. We’re just constantly on John Carpenter’s Big problems in Little China and all these movies.”

The producer also explains how Wilson reminds him of Leigh Whannell, another filmmaker whose acting experience helped him a lot with his directing.

“Patrick kind of reminds me of Leigh Whannell in that it’s not just actors who cut whatever; they’re also filmmakers. They’re movie buffs, and as movie buffs, they look at acting from the point of view of what the final movie will be.” And that actually helps inform them as filmmakers. So I’m always really excited when people like Leigh Whannell and Patrick Wilson want to jump behind the camera.”

Wilson continued filming Treacherous: Fear the dark in August. At the time, his wife, Dagmara Dominiczyk, was teasing a strong sequel that fans should appreciate after several weeks of putting “blood, sweat, and tears” into the film.

“6 weeks of (fake) blood, sweat and tears, and now it’s all mine again,” Dominczyk wrote on Twitter. “So proud [Wilson] directed a movie (and killed him, no pun intended) but man oh man, we sure missed him.

Leigh Whannell came up with the story for it Treacherous: Fear the dark with Scott Teems writing the script. Along with Patrick Wilson, Ty Simpkins and Rose Byrne also return to reprise their roles as the Lamberts. Peter Dager, Jarquez McClendon, Sinclair Daniel and Hiam Abbass also star.

Treacherous: Fear the dark will be released on July 7, 2023.
